K3 Capital, an investment firm specializing in DeFi strategies, has launched an on-chain credit line for the financial company Galaxy on the Monad network, built on the Accountable platform, which provides cryptographic verification of data on the blockchain. Investors have contributed a total of $30 million. As new liquidity providers join, the credit line volume is planned to increase to $100 million.

The credit line operates based on a liquidity pool denominated in AUSD. Investors deposit funds into it, K3 Capital manages the capital, and Galaxy receives borrowed financing. All fund transactions, loan status, and interest payments can be verified on the blockchain at any time through the Accountable verification system.

The product is designed for institutional investors. Each loan is provided for 90 days with the possibility of renewal, and investors can withdraw up to 30% of their funds monthly. Additionally, participants receive tokenized shares in the pool, which can be used in other DeFi protocols within the Monad ecosystem, for example, to generate additional yield or in secondary lending services.

Wall Street Begins to Question Tech Giants' AI Narrative

Wall Street Questions the AI Narrative of Tech Giants Wall Street is shifting its focus from the hype surrounding artificial intelligence (AI) to a rigorous financial reality check. Following strong earnings reports from companies like Google and a massive $500 billion financing initiative from Nvidia for AI infrastructure, the market reaction has been mixed and skeptical. The core concern revolves around the massive capital expenditure (CapEx) required for AI development—building data centers and acquiring chips—and whether future cash flows can justify these upfront costs. Investors are now scrutinizing free cash flow (FCF), which measures the cash left after operational expenses and capital investments. A negative FCF, as seen recently with Alphabet (Google's parent company), signals heavy immediate spending, even if profits are growing. The divergent stock reactions highlight this new scrutiny. Microsoft's stock surged after its earnings, supported by strong operating cash flow, growing cloud revenue (Azure), and a large backlog of committed business. In contrast, Alphabet's stock fell despite profit growth because its capital spending caused FCF to turn negative for the first time. Similarly, Nvidia's announcement of a $500 billion financing platform, while potentially expanding its market, raised questions about whether AI build-out has become too expensive for tech companies to fund internally. Analysts are moving beyond simply asking if there is AI demand—which cloud revenue growth confirms—to deeper questions: the speed at which AI investments translate into revenue, profit, and ultimately, cash returns. The market is evaluating the "return on invested capital" (ROIC) over the long term, considering factors like rapid chip obsolescence, energy costs, and future competition. In summary, Wall Street's AI narrative is evolving from grand vision to a detailed financial and operational examination. The key question is no longer if AI is transformative, but whether companies can generate cash returns fast enough to outpace the immense costs of building it. Free cash flow has become a critical first filter in this reassessment.
